Output 30c06d40a517bae7096515ef62a6cf022173694e01d63eeccf7fb8cf064429da:0

value
245000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2801a92fef2527001573483241194a997417435 OP_EQUAL
address
3NLe6htpLfRfjzUS28N5HWoaSMY7BDvMsD
transaction
30c06d40a517bae7096515ef62a6cf022173694e01d63eeccf7fb8cf064429da
confirmations
114738
spent
true